MIDDLESEX IN THE COMMUNITY IS LOOKING TO APPOINT TRUSTEES

MIDDLESEX IN THE COMMUNITY | APPOINTMENT OF TRUSTEES

Middlesex in the Community (MITC) is a new initiative charged with the delivery of physical activity, health, education, wellbeing, and social inclusion in Middlesex. We are the participation and community arm of Middlesex County Cricket Club (MCCC), and whilst governed by our own board of Trustees, we report periodically into the club’s main board.

Our mission is to increase participation and engagement across our diverse county and run exciting projects which deliver lasting impact, making cricket more accessible for all. We want everyone to say that ‘cricket is a game for me’, and are committed to equity, diversity, and inclusivity at every level. We are also committed to removing barriers to engagement and participation, particularly amongst communities that have a history of exclusion and who are underrepresented in the grassroots and professional levels.

We want to grow and strengthen the game, support our local communities, and inspire the county we serve by drawing on the knowledge of our people, the reach of our brand, and our cricket expertise to deliver positive outcomes.
